WLD Technical Analysis: Setting Up for Potential Breakdown
The Worldcoin technical analysis reveals concerning momentum signals that support the bearish short-term predictions. With WLD trading at $0.64, the token sits precisely at its 20-day SMA, indicating a critical decision point for price direction.
The RSI reading of 43.38 places Worldcoin in neutral territory, neither oversold nor overbought, which typically suggests indecision in the market. However, the MACD configuration tells a more nuanced story. While the MACD line sits at -0.0418 in bearish territory, the positive MACD histogram of 0.0094 indicates potential bullish momentum building beneath the surface.
Volume analysis shows $18.6 million in 24-hour trading activity on Binance, which represents moderate liquidity but lacks the conviction needed for a strong directional move. The Bollinger Bands positioning at 0.4979 suggests WLD is trading in the lower half of its recent range, supporting the bearish near-term outlook.
Most concerning for bulls is WLD's position relative to longer-term moving averages. Trading 14.7% below the 50-day SMA ($0.75) and a significant 37.9% below the 200-day SMA ($1.03) indicates the prevailing trend remains bearish despite recent stabilization attempts.
